bill mcdonough
saxophones

Playing single reeds since age 11, Bill’s career spans London gigs, recording with Nigel Gray at Surrey Sound Studios, commercial TV/radio soundtracks, and 10 years with 'No Jacket Required'. His credits include featuring on music for the hit tv series 'lovejoy', Austrian ski seasons with 'Riforama', 'Mike Wheeler' in Chicago, European tours with Dave Finnegan’s 'Commitments', and recording artist Jackson Sloan. He currently performs with The' British Bluescasting Corporation', 'Jump 66', 'Funky Fury Shaker' and The 'Audacity'.
john donald
guitar

John started gigging in Croydon’s pubs, including The Cartoon, before playing London’s Hard Rock Café. Though never a full-time pro, he has shared stages with members of 'Mud', 'Motörhead', '10cc' and 'Queen' touring musicians. He formed Zen Relics in 2009 and The 'Audacity' in 2012, leading both through a five-year Shockfest residency in Sussex. His enduring passion remains the elusive “clean” guitar tone.
steve brothwood
trombone

steve started performing early as a chorister with the liverpool Cathedral choir from the age of 8. He started playing cello around the same time and switched to trombone because it was easier to carry! he has performed with many bands and orchestras over the last 20 years, from traditional brass bands and big band jazz to salsa, soul and funk. he was one of the original bb horns, the horn section for the sussex soul band 'the blunter brothers' - and while with them worked with soul legends geno washington and ruby turner. steve also plays percussion and is famous for his TUMBA & percussion skills especially in tribute band 'no jacket required'
JEFF SCARRY
bass guitar

Jeff has been playing bass since the age of 14, attended chichester college to study for a jazz diploma & has decades of live performance experience across a wide range of bands and musical styles. he has been part of well-known acts including 'Firewater', 'Wail Nation', 'Bad Boy Boogie' & 'Scaramouche'. For the past 14 years, Jeff has also been part of the tribute band No 'Jacket Required', earning a reputation for solid groove and a strong stage presence. matt hammond
keyboards

Matt began playing the piano aged 7, inspired by his father - a keen Boogie Woogie player. He has played professionally for over four decades, performing in numerous bands covering all genres. Throughout the 90s, Matt was the keyboard player in original bands 'The End' and 'Lunaseed'. Gigging in all the major London venues such as the Marquee, Astoria and Hippodrome, and also in Europe, they supported the likes of 'Status Quo', 'Cockney Rebel', 'Manfred Mann', 'The Ramones' and 'The Damned'.
*Fun fact* When Matt was 19, he was in a band with Cass Gale’s mum!
